Today marks one of the most powerful moments in American history - June 19, 1865, when the last enslaved people in Galveston, Texas received word of their freedom, more than two years after the Emancipation Proclamation.
Juneteenth is a day of reflection, remembrance, and celebration. It honors the strength and resilience of those who endured enslavement - and reminds us all that the work of building a more just and equitable society is ongoing.
